The Wave - A movie about cults
tags:I saw this in elementary school and I thought it was great. I still do, so here it is on the sift. :)
Based on the real experience of a high school class in Palo Alto, CA in April 1967, whose teacher wanted to explain the rise of the Nazi party to his students.
